This is a list of national birds, most official, but some unofficial:
- Angola - Peregrine Falcon, Falco peregrinus [1]
- Anguilla - Zenaida Dove, Zenaida aurita (Locally known as Turtle Dove)
- Antigua and Barbuda - Magnificent Frigatebird, Fregata magnificens [2]
- Argentina - Rufous Hornero, Furnarius rufus [3]
- Australia - Emu, Dromaius novaehollandiae (unofficial [4])
- Austria - Golden Eagle, Aquila chrysaetos
- Bahamas - Caribbean Flamingo, Phoenicopterus ruber [5]
- Bahrain - White-cheeked Bulbul, Pycnonotus leucogenys
- Bangladesh - Oriental Magpie Robin, Copsychus saularis (doayle, dhayal) [6]
- Belarus - White Stork, Ciconia ciconia
- Belgium - Common Kestrel, Falco tinninculus
- Belize - Keel-billed Toucan, Ramphastos sulfuratus [7]
- Bhutan - Common Raven Corvus corax [8]
- Bolivia - Andean Condor, Vultur gryphus
- Botswana - Lilac-breasted Roller, Coracias caudata or Cattle Egret, Bubulcus ibis [9]
- Brazil - Rufous-bellied Thrush, Turdus rufiventris (sabiá-laranjeira) [10]
- Chile - Andean Condor, Vultur gryphus
- China - as yet undetermined, suggestions include Blue-eared Pheasant and Red-crowned Crane [11]
- Colombia - Andean Condor, Vultur gryphus
- Costa Rica - King Vulture, Sarcoramphus papa
- Cuba - Cuban Trogon, Priotelus temnurus (tocororo)
- Denmark - Mute Swan, Cygnus olor
- Dominica - Imperial Parrot, Amazona imperialis (Sisserou)
- Dominican Republic - Palmchat, Dulus dominicus
- Ecuador - Andean Condor, Vultur gryphus
- El Salvador - Turquoise-browed Motmot, Eumomota superciliosa (Torogoz) [12]
- Estonia - Barn Swallow, Hirundo rustica [13]
- Fiji - Collared Lory, Phigys solitarius (kula)
- Finland - Whooper Swan, Cygnus cygnus
- France - Cock, Gallus gallus
- The Gambia - as yet undetermined, suggestions include Blue-bellied Roller and Spur-winged Goose [14]
- Georgia - Common Pheasant, Phasianus colchicus
- Germany - Golden Eagle, Aquila chrysaetos
- Grenada - Grenada Dove, Leptotila wellsi
- Guatemala - Resplendent Quetzal, Pharomachrus mocinno
- Guyana - Hoatzin, Opisthocomus hoazin
- Haiti - Hispaniolan Trogon, Temnotrogon roseigaster
- Honduras - Yellow-naped Parrot, Amazona auropalliata
- Hungary - Great Bustard, Otis tarda - (unofficially the symbol of the Magyar nation: Turul or Saker Falcon.)
- Iceland - Gyrfalcon, Falco rusticolus
- Republic of India - blue Indian Peacock male, Pavo cristatus
- Indonesia - Javan Hawk Eagle, Spizaetus bartelsi
- Iran - Nightingale, Luscinia megarhynchos, Male Peacock, Pavo cristatus (Both Unofficial)
- Iraq - Chukar, Alectoris chukar
- Israel - Hoopoe, Upupa epops major (Hebrew: Doochifat דוכיפת)
- Republic of Ireland - as yet undetermined, suggestions include wren and robin
- Jamaica - Green-and-black Streamertail, Trochilus polytmus (doctor bird)
- Japan - Green Pheasant, Phasianus versicolor (kiji)
- Jordan - Sinai Rosefinch, Carpodacus synoicus
- Kazakhstan - Golden Eagle, Aquila chrysaetos
- Kenya - rooster, Gallus gallus or Black Crowned Crane, Balearica pavonina (both unofficial)
- South Korea - Korean Magpie, Pica sericea
- Latvia - White Wagtail, Motacilla alba
- Lesotho - Southern Bald Ibis, Geronticus calvus
- Liberia - Common Bulbul, Pycnonotus barbatus (pepperbird)
- Lithuania - White Stork, Ciconia ciconia
- Luxembourg - Goldcrest, Regulus regulus
- Malawi - Bar-tailed Trogon, Apaloderma vittatum [15]
- Malaysia - Rhinoceros Hornbill, Buceros rhinoceros
- Malta - Blue Rock Thrush, Monticola solitarius
- Mauritius - Dodo, Raphus cucullatus
- Mexico - Golden Eagle, Aquila chrysaetos (official stance currently does not specify any species)
- Myanmar (Burma) - Grey Peacock Pheasant, Polyplectron bicalcaratum (Burmese peacock)
- Namibia - Crimson-breasted Shrike, Laniarius atrococcineus [16]
- Nepal - Himalayan Monal, Lophophorus impejanus (danphe)
- New Zealand - Brown Kiwi, Apteryx australis
- Nicaragua - Turquoise-browed Motmot, Eumomota superciliosa (guardabarranco)
- Nigeria - Black-crowned Crane, Balearica pavonina
- Norway - White-throated Dipper, Cinclus cinclus
- Pakistan - Chukar, Alectoris chukar (National bird) and Peregrine Falcon Falco peregrinus (State military bird)
- Palau - Palau Fruit Dove, Ptilinopus pelewensis
- Panama - Harpy Eagle, Harpia harpyja [17]
- Papua New Guinea - Raggiana Bird of Paradise, Paradisaea raggiana [18]
- Paraguay - Bare-throated Bellbird, Procnias nudicollis
- Peru - Andean Cock-of-the-rock, Rupicola peruviana
- Philippines - Philippine Eagle, Pithecophaga jefferyi
- Poland - White-tailed Eagle, Haliaeetus albicilla
- Romania - White Pelican, Pelecanus onocrotalus (proposed)
- Rwanda - Grey Crowned Crane, Balearica regulorum (unofficial)
- Saint Kitts and Nevis - Brown Pelican, Pelecanus occidentalis
- Saint Lucia - St. Lucia Parrot, Amazona versicolor
- Saint Vincent and the Grenadines - St. Vincent Parrot, Amazona guildingii
- Samoa - Tooth-billed Pigeon, Didunculus strigirostris (manumea)
- Sao Tome and Principe - African Grey Parrot, Psittacus erithacus and Black Kite, Milvus migrans
- Seychelles - Seychelles Black Parrot, Coracopsis nigra barklyi
- Singapore - Crimson Sunbird, Aethopyga siparaja [19]
- South Africa - Blue Crane, Anthropoides paradisea [20]
- Sri Lanka - Sri Lanka Junglefowl, Gallus lafayetti
- Sudan - Secretary Bird, Sagittarius serpentarius
- Swaziland - Purple-crested Turaco, Tauraco porphyreolophus [21]
- Sweden - Common Blackbird, Turdus merula
- Taiwan - Formosan Blue Magpie, Urocissa caerulea
- Tanzania - Grey Crowned Crane, Balearica regulorum (unofficial)
- Thailand - Siamese Fireback, Lophura diardi
- Tonga - Pacific Imperial Pigeon, Ducula pacifica (lupe)
- Trinidad and Tobago
- Trinidad - Scarlet Ibis, Eudocimus ruber
- Tobago - Rufous-vented Chachalaca, Ortalis ruficauda (cocrico)
- Turkey - Redwing, Turdus iliacus
- Uganda - Grey-crowned Crane, Balearica regulorum
- United Arab Emirates - Peregrine Falcon, Falco peregrinus
- United Kingdom - European Robin, Erithacus rubecula
- United States - Bald Eagle, Haliaeetus leucocephalus [22]
- Uruguay - Southern Lapwing, Vanellus chilensis (terutero, tero tero)
- Venezuela - Troupial, Icterus icterus (turpial) [23]
- Zambia - African Fish Eagle, Haliaeetus vocifer [24]
- Zimbabwe - African Fish Eagle, Haliaeetus vocifer [25]
Official birds of subnational entities
- Australia (see also list of Australian bird emblems)
- Australian Capital Territory - Gang-gang Cockatoo, Callocephalon fimbriatum
- Queensland - Brolga, Grus rubicunda
- New South Wales - Laughing Kookaburra, Dacelo novaeguineae
- Northern Territory - Wedge-tailed Eagle, Aquila audax
- South Australia - White-backed Magpie, Gymnorhina tibicen telonocua (Piping Shrike)
- Victoria - Helmeted Honeyeater, Lichenostomus melanops cassidix
- Western Australia - Black Swan, Cygnus atratus
- Canada
- Alberta - Great Horned Owl, Bubo virginianus
- British Columbia - Steller's Jay, Cyanocitta stelleri
- Manitoba -- Great Gray Owl, Strix nebulosa
- New Brunswick - Black-capped Chickadee, Poecile atricapilla
- Newfoundland and Labrador - Atlantic Puffin, Fratercula Arctica
- Northwest Territories - Gyrfalcon, Falco rusticolus
- Nova Scotia - Osprey, Pandion haliaetus
- Nunavut - Rock Ptarmigan, Lagopus muta
- Ontario - Common Loon, Gavia immer
- Prince Edward Island - Blue Jay, Cyanocitta cristata
- Quebec - Snowy Owl, Nyctea scandiaca
- Saskatchewan - Sharp-tailed Grouse, Tympanuchus phasianellus
- Yukon - Common Raven, Corvus corax
- China
- Guangdong - Silver Pheasant, Lophura nycthemera
- Hainan - Hainan Partridge, Arborophila ardens
- Ningxia - Blue-eared Pheasant, Crossoptilon auritum
- Qinghai - Black-necked Crane, Grus nigricollis
- Shaanxi - Japanese Crested Ibis, Nipponia nippon
- Shanxi - Brown-eared Pheasant, Crossoptilon mantchuricum
- Denmark
- Faroe Islands - Eurasian Oystercatcher, Haematopus ostralegus
- France
- New Caledonia - Kagu, Rhynochetos jubatus
- India, ** see List of Indian state birds
- Japan
- Aichi - Japanese Scops Owl, Otus semitorques
- Akita - Copper Pheasant, Phasianus soemmeringii
- Aomori - Bewick's Swan, Cygnus bewickii
- Chiba - Meadow Bunting, Emberiza cioides
- Ehime - Japanese Robin, Erithacus akahige
- Fukui - Dusky Thrush, Turdus naumanni
- Fukuoka - Japanese Bush Warbler, Cettia diphone
- Fukushima - Narcissus Flycatcher, Ficedula narcissina
- Gifu - Rock Ptarmigan, Lagopus muta
- Gunma - Copper Pheasant, Phasianus soemmeringii
- Hiroshima - Red-throated Diver, Gavia stellata
- Hokkaidō - Red-crowned Crane, Grus japonensis
- Hyōgo - Oriental White Stork, Ciconia boyciana
- Ibaraki - Japanese Skylark, Alauda japonica
- Ishikawa - Golden Eagle, Aquila chrysaetos
- Iwate - Common Pheasant, Phasianus colchicus
- Kagawa - Lesser Cuckoo, Cuculus poliocephalus
- Kagoshima - Lidth's Jay, Garrulus lidthi
- Kanagawa - Common Gull, Larus canus
- Kochi - Fairy Pitta, Pitta nympha
- Kumamoto - Japanese Skylark, Alauda japonica
- Kyoto - Streaked Shearwater, Calonectris leucomelas
- Mie - Kentish Plover, Charadrius alexandrinus
- Miyagi - "wild goose" (Anser, Branta, and Chen)
- Miyazaki - Ijima Copper Pheasant, Phasianus soemmerringii ijimae
- Nagano - Rock Ptarmigan, Lagopus muta
- Nagasaki - Mandarin Duck, Aix galericulata
- Nara - Japanese Robin, Erithacus akahige
- Niigata - Japanese Crested Ibis, Nipponia nippon
- Ōita - Japanese White-eye, Zosterops japonica
- Okayama - Lesser Cuckoo, Cuculus poliocephalus
- Okinawa - Okinawa Woodpecker, Sapheopipo noguchii
- Osaka - Bull-headed Shrike, Lanius bucephalus
- Saga - Black-billed Magpie, Pica pica
- Saitama - Eurasian Collared Dove, Streptopelia decaocto
- Shiga - Little Grebe, Tachybaptus ruficollis
- Shimane - Whooper Swan, Cygnus cygnus
- Shizuoka - Japanese Paradise Flycatcher, Terpsiphone atrocaudata
- Tochigi - Blue-and-white Flycatcher, Cyanoptila cyanomelana
- Tokushima - "white heron" (Ardea and Egretta)
- Tokyo - Black-headed Gull, Larus ridibundus
- Tottori - Mandarin Duck, Aix galericulata
- Toyama - Rock Ptarmigan, Lagopus muta
- Wakayama - Japanese White-eye, Zosterops japonica
- Yamagata - Mandarin Duck, Aix galericulata
- Yamaguchi - Hooded Crane, Grus monacha
- Yamanashi - Japanese Bush Warbler, Cettia diphone
- Malaysia
- Sarawak - Rhinoceros Hornbill, Buceros rhinoceros
- Selangor - White-bellied Sea Eagle, Haliaeetus leucogaster
- Netherlands
- Bonaire - Caribbean Flamingo, Phoenicopterus ruber
- Pakistan
- Philippines
- Antique - Writhed-billed Hornbill, Aceros waldeni (dulungan, kalaw)
- Abra - Writhed-billed Hornbill, Aceros waldeni (kalaw)
- Bohol - Black-naped Oriole, Oriolus chinensis (antolihaw, dimodlaw)
- Cebu - Cebu Flowerpecker, Dicaeum quadricolor
- United Kingdom
- Anguilla - Mourning Dove, Zenaida macroura
- Bermuda - White-tailed Tropicbird, Phaethon lepturus
- British Virgin Islands - Mourning Dove, Zenaida macroura
- Cayman Islands - Cayman Parrot, Amazona leucocephala caymanensis
- Cornwall - Red-billed Chough, Pyrrhocorax pyrrhocorax [26]
- Montserrat - Montserrat Oriole, Icterus oberi
- Saint Helena - Wirebird (St. Helena Plover), Charadrius sanctaehelenae
- Scotland - Golden Eagle, Aquila chrysaetos
- United States
- District of Columbia - Wood Thrush, Hylocichla mustelina
- Guam - Mariana Fruit Dove, Ptilinopus roseicapilla (totot)
- Puerto Rico - Puerto Rican Spindalis, Spindalis portoricensis (reina mora)
- United States Virgin Islands - Bananaquit, Coereba flaveola
